Park Sharks Team Groups

The overall goal of the program is to develop competitive and proficient swimmers while having a great time!! However, each group has guidelines for appropriateness as well as goal to attain before getting approved to the next group.

 

Beginners/Baby Sharks
o Must not require coaxing to get into the water
o Must be able to swim 5-10 feet without physical assistance
o Must follow coach instructions to coach's discretion
o Limited spots to coach's discretion
o Goal is to be able to swim a full 25 yd at a swim meet

 

Intermediate
o Must be able to swim across the full length of the pool without floatation device
o Must demonstrate maturity to begin learning appropriate technique for strokes
o Goal will be to be able to learn all 4 strokes, demonstrate appropriate diving
technique, and learn a flip turn

               o Intermediate goal may take multiple seasons due to age, maturity, and
                  readiness to advance

 

Advanced
o Must be able to complete a flip turn without disqualification
o Must know all 4 strokes
o Goal will be to continue to master stroke and diving techniques as well as build
endurance
